Show that the line 4y=5x-10 is perpendicular to the line 5y+4x=35 plz quickly answer |
|
Answer» concept :- When TWO lines are perpendicular , then the product of their slopes is equivalent to -1. Equation of line in the form y = mx + C have m as slope of line and c as y-intercept.
Solution:- GIVEN equations of lines are- 4y = 5x-10 or, y = (5/4)x - (5/2). .....(i) 5y + 4x = 35 or,y = (-4/5)x + 7. .....(II) Let m and n be the slope of equations i and ii, respectively. Here, m = 5/4 n= -4/5 therefore, m× n = -1 Hence, the lines are perpendicular. |

A Piece of wire is used to make circles of the following pattern.The radius of the first circle is ‘ r ‘ cm and increased by 1 cm successively.Find the length of the wire that is required to make 5 such circles.(take π= 22/7) |
|
Answer» Given : The radius of the FIRST circle is ‘ R ‘ cm and increased by 1 cm successively To find : the LENGTH of the wire that is required to make 5 such circles.(take π= 22/7) Solution: radius of 1st circle = r cm radius of 2nd circle = r + 1 cm radius of 3rd circle = r + 2 cm radius of 4th circle = r + 3 cm radius of 5th circle = r + 4 cm Perimeter of circle = 2π* Radius Total wire required = 2π ( r + (r + 1) + (r + 2) + (r + 3) + (r + 4)) = 2π(5r + 10) = 10π(r + 2) = 10 (22/7)(r + 2) = 220(r + 2)/7 cm 10π(r + 2) cm or 220(r + 2)/7 cm is the length of the wire that is required to make 5 such circles Learn more: find perimeter and area of shaded region as show in figure - Brainly.in Calculate the perimeter and area of a quadrant of the circles whose ... |
